1. Srinagar, Jammu and Kashmir

From the beautiful Mughal gardens to the stunning Dal Lake, there’s a lot to do in and around Srinagar. Being one of the most romantic places for a honeymoon in India, Srinagar has something for every couple.

Couples can visit the 17th-century Hazratbal Shrine, Shalimar Bagh, Nishat Bagh, and the Indira Gandhi Memorial Tulip Garden. You can also sign up for heritage walks, explore the uncluttered Nigeen Lake, or simply dig into some delicious local favorites.

2. Coorg, Karnataka

If you are the kind of couple who wants to unwind and relax, then Coorg is the best place to honeymoon in India for you. One of the top 10 hill stations in India, this quaint location offers an array of coffee plantations, perfect weather, and cozy stays.

You can visit the Pushpagiri Wildlife Sanctuary, Abbey Falls, and Raja’s Seat. If you are looking for something more laid-back, then go shopping at the local markets, or simply enjoy the natural beauty.

5. Rann of Kutch, Gujarat

What could be more romantic than looking at the endless white desert under the full moon? A three-to-four-day trip is ideal to explore the Rann of Kutch. You can spend your days spotting the endangered animals with an open-air jeep safari. Or you can add romance with camel rides or soaking in the local culture.

Many travelers also prefer to explore local villages known for arts like embroidery, leatherwork, and beadwork.

6. Gulmarg, Jammu & Kashmir

Among one of the top 10 beautiful places in India, Gulmarg is one of the top destinations for winter sports like snowboarding, skiing, and ice skating. Couples can wake up to serene mountain views, enjoy a cable car ride at the Gulmarg Gondola, or even explore the valleys and meadows of flowers.

Gulmarg offers one of the highest 18-hole golf courses in the world. It also has the historic Maharaja Palace, the Baba Reshi Shrine, and an array of hiking trails.

7. Shimla, Himachal Pradesh

Shimla is known for its stunning landscapes, picturesque spots, and national parks. This hill station is quite a popular destination for couples as it features several 200-year-old temples, bird parks, and the Kalka-Shimla train route which is a UNESCO World Heritage site.

Honeymooners can also visit the Chail Palace, Jakhoo Hill, and the Naldhera and Shaily Peak.

10. Chikmagalur, Karnataka

One of the top holiday destinations in India, Chikmagalur is perfect for couples seeking peacefulness and romance. This small town offers pretty views, vast coffee estates, and a quiet getaway.

Here travelers can explore the Mullayanagiri Peak, go on coffee estate tours, and visit the Baba Budangiri Hill and the Manikyadhara Falls.
